AAPT2: Process <java-symbols> and private symbol package

Need to introduce the idea of multiple levels of visibility to support <java-symbol>.

Public, Private, Undefined.

Public means it is accessible from outside and requires an ID assigned.
Private means that we explicitly want this to be a symbol (show up in R.java), but not visible
to other packages. No ID required.

Undefined is any normal resource. When --private-symbols is specified in the link phase,
these resources will not show up in R.java.
